Praise for Nando

Last updated : 27 May 2006 By Al Campbell
Morientes yesterday returned to Spain after signing for Valencia for an undisclosed sum, believed to be around the £3m mark. Rafa Benitez praised the striker for his contribution to the Reds' excellent form this season.

"He has contributed a lot since he joined us, but I spoke to him at the end of the season and we agreed if a good Spanish club was interested in him he could talk to them," said Benitez.
 
"Since he joined us he has been a good professional and helped the team a lot. He has played mainly as a second striker since he joined, which is a difficult position and you must do a lot of hard work to create a lot of space for other forwards.
 
"If you speak to the other strikers, they will all tell you how they liked working alongside him. Fernando always tried hard in this position and maybe he didn't always get the credit he deserved for his work.
 
"He joined Liverpool at an important time and played a key role to us. He's helped a lot of the other players with his attitude and professionalism.
 
"He joined us as a big star, but his attitude was always good. Maybe he's had a bit more of a problem than some of the others such as Luis, Xabi and Pepe in adjusting to England and I know he was also thinking about his family."
